Evergreen Mountain Castle

Evergreen Mountain Castle Address: 1361 Santa Fe Mountain Rd, Idaho Springs, United States

Minimum price found for Evergreen Mountain Castle was: Null USD

Click here to get more information, photos & guest ratings for Evergreen Mountain Castle